iMetaOmics:統合されたメタオミクスを通じて,人間と環境の健康を向上させる
Chun-Lin Shi1, Tong Chen2, Canhui Lan3,4
1ANGENOVO Oslo Norway.
まとめ
iMetaOmicsは,オミックスのデータを用いてOne Healthに関する研究を発表しています. また,公開データセットを統合し,新しい洞察を得るために既存のデータを再分析する研究も掲載しています.

Directing Effect of Substituents: meta-Directing Groups
6.0K
Substituents on the benzene ring that direct an incoming electrophile to undergo substitution at the meta position are called meta directors. All meta directors either have a positive charge on the atom directly bonded to the ring or a partial positive charge. These groups function by withdrawing electrons from the ring through inductive and resonance effects. Integration by Parts: Indefinite Integrals
230
Integration by parts is a fundamental technique in calculus for evaluating integrals involving the product of two functions. It is particularly useful when direct integration is not feasible. The method is based on the product rule for differentiation, which states that the derivative of a product equals the derivative of the first function times the second, plus the first function times the derivative of the second. Health Literacy
5.4K
Health literacy is an individual's or a community's capacity to comprehend, receive, read, and use relevant healthcare information and services. The World Health Organization (WHO, 2018) defines health literacy as the cognitive and social skills that determine the ability of individuals to gain access to, understand, and use information in ways that promote and maintain good health. Metal ions can be separated from one another by complexation with organic ligands–the chelating agent– to form uncharged chelates. Here, the chelating agent must contain hydrophobic groups and behave as a weak acid, losing a proton to bind with the metal. Since most organic ligands used in this process are insoluble or undergo oxidation in the aqueous phase, the chelating agent is initially added to the organic phase and extracted into the aqueous phase.
